Charles was born about 1660, son of Robert Petit de Levilliers and Élisabeth Berruyer.
The baptism of his daughter Louise cites him as captain of a detachement of marine troops.[1]
Charles Petit de Livilliers was buried on 2 July 1714 in Montréal (ND), the record giving him 53 years of age.[2]
